Output cbd63a0b1028b7ef3899d513fca5bf776bfa187f9d286dcfb63c20f4304eae93:0

value
4687637
script pubkey
OP_0 OP_PUSHBYTES_20 21dbebf192815e86eeffa8e01ebf5aa32ec1ba35
address
bc1qy8d7huvjs90gdmhl4rspa0665vhvrw34f7qajg
transaction
cbd63a0b1028b7ef3899d513fca5bf776bfa187f9d286dcfb63c20f4304eae93
confirmations
32790
spent
true